Blue Hens Earn 10th CAA Win of Season; Top William & Mary, 61-52
2/23/2018 10:18:00 PM | Women's Basketball
WILLIAMSBURG, Va. – Junior Nicole Enabosi notched her 20th double double of the season as Delaware defeated William & Mary, 61-52, at Kaplan Arena.
The Gaithersburg, Md. native (Our Lady of Good Counsel) collected 24 points and 14 rebounds to lead the Blue Hens (17-9, 10-5 CAA) to their 17th win of the season, the most for Delaware since the 2013-14 campaign.
Sophomore Samone DeFreese (Bergenfield, N.J./Berkshire) added 13 points, seven points, two assists, two blocked shots and two steals while classmate Abby Gonzales (Wexford, Pa./North Allegheny) posted eight points, five rebounds and five assists in 39 minutes of action.
The Tribe (16-11, 7-9 CAA) saw four players with double-digit scoring efforts while seniors Jenna Green and Abby Rendle led the way with 12 points apiece.

HEN SCRATCHINGS
· The Blue Hens have reached 17 wins for the first time since the 2013-14 campaign.
· Delaware has won at least 10 CAA regular season games for the third straight season and sixth of the last seven.
· UD led the Tribe in rebounds (45-32), steals (10-6) and assists (14-10).
· The Hens led by as much as 18 in the third quarter.
· Delaware has won nine straight over the Tribe in Williamsburg.
